Can you implement a cartridge legal sleep clause? The current option on Pokemon Showdown creates battle conditions that are impossible to replicate on the cartridge. This is a lot less minor than you might think - for example, a Choice locked Sleep move is much safer in PS as you won't lose the game if you stay in. Spamming Spore and hoping that Blissey you slept was Natural Cure is a risk free strategy in PS when it is extremely risky on cartridge.
I'm not saying Smogon should change its policies (well, I think they should, but it's a separate issue), but for those of us that want to host servers that replicate game mechanics perfectly, we should have the option.

As you've noticed, I made the thread you linked to.I am well aware that there is no "soft sleep clause" in any game. That's why I made my post. I am asking for PS coders, if they wish, to make a "hard Sleep Clause" that does not rely on changing game mechanics. The simplest is "If two Pokemon on the opponents team are asleep at the end of a turn, you lose." However, that version doesn't account for self-inflicted Sleep moves.
If you wish to claim PS is a "Pokemon simulator", you can't have soft Sleep Clause. The game is no longer Pokemon if a battle could not be played on a Pokemon cartridge.
